Thanks Dean, where did you find this? From the schematic it looks like the orange wire I disconnected goes to the blower motor sw for the dash AC. It was the one causing the parasitic drain. Good news is that the rig has sat now for several days with the chassis disconnect turned on and the battery is holding a good charge. Tested it yesterday afternoon and it was at 12.43v.
Question; on a charging system that is operating properly, no parasitic drains and battery at full charge, what would be considered "normal" drop in voltage over what period of time??

Your more than welcome Dean.
On the earlier models Chevy published a 'master' manual every major year change and then a supplement for each year; so for my 1975, I have the '74 manual and the '75 supplement. Not sure if it is the same for later models, but worth keeping in mind.

Got around to a couple projects over the past few days. I needed to finish the dog house cover first of all. I had installed some temporary cup holders and a plastic waterproof marine head unit case to get us by till I got to the permanent install. When I got my rig there was no entertainment center or glove box AND the PO had carpeted over the bolts to remove the dog house for maintenance. Got the top covered in a combination of an aluminum cover for the front panel and then padded and covered the rest in the couch fabric a couple weeks ago. The past couple days I worked on building head unit case. Wanted an old school looking case like an older Kenwood receiver power amp. Built the box out of plywood and banded the front with walnut to match the fold out table. Then I laminated aluminum over the plywood. Added the head unit, map light with push button latching sw, and found a pretty cool Airstream logo to finish it off;
Then Shepard57 (John ) was
Nice enough to bring down the rear passenger side wheel well trim to replace mine that had been boogered up pretty bad by the previous owner.
We thought it was a direct replacement but the one John had was about 3" too wide. So I ended up cutting out the 3" from the straight top part of the trim and ended up with a joint. I don't have a metal chop saw so I had to use my jog saw to make the cuts. Unless you were looking for it, I think the joint is pretty unnoticeabe.

Yes Mike, it was the original plastic Entertainment center with an 8-track player. I painted it silver, cut out the "Airstream Entertainment Center" and replaced the flimsy face plate with a thick alu plate.
You still have lots of room to add lights and switches. Always nice to have an actual voltmeter for the coach batteries.
